Metal cladding replacement services involve removing existing metal panels and installing new cladding to improve a building’s exterior. This process typically includes assessing the current cladding condition, preparing the surface, and securely attaching the new panels to ensure durability and aesthetic appeal. Professionals specializing in cladding replacement use various materials and techniques to ensure the new cladding fits properly and provides long-lasting protection against weather elements.
These services address common issues such as corrosion, dents, warping, or damage caused by severe weather conditions. Over time, metal cladding can deteriorate, leading to leaks, reduced insulation, and compromised structural integrity. Replacing worn or damaged panels helps maintain the building’s safety, appearance, and energy efficiency. It also provides an opportunity to update the exterior with modern materials or finishes, enhancing the property’s overall look.

Material Replacement Costs - Replacing metal cladding typically ranges from $8 to $15 per square foot, depending on the type of metal and complexity of the project. For example, a 1,000-square-foot area might cost between $8,000 and $15,000. Prices can vary based on material choices and local labor rates.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for metal cladding replacement generally fall between $3,000 and $7,000 for standard-sized projects. Larger or more intricate installations may increase labor expenses accordingly.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Additional Costs - Expenses such as removing old cladding, disposal, and site preparation can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all cost. These costs vary depending on the existing condition of the structure and project scope.
Cost Factors - Total costs are influenced by material choice, building size, and accessibility. Variations in local labor rates and project complexity can also impact the final price. Contact local service providers for accurate est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is metal cladding replacement? Metal cladding replacement involves removing existing exterior metal panels and installing new ones to enhance appearance and durability of a building's facade.
How do I know if my metal cladding needs replacing? Signs such as rust, corrosion, dents, or significant damage may indicate that metal cladding requires replacement; a local contractor can assess its condition.
What types of metal panels are used for cladding replacement? Common options include aluminum, steel, and zinc panels, each offering different aesthetic and performance qualities.
How long does metal cladding repl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the project and materials used, but local service providers can provide estimates during consultation.
What are the benefits of replacing metal cladding? Replacing metal cladding can improve building appearance, increase protection against the elements, and extend the structure's lifespan.
